To access the portable storage device by the FTP server, do as follows. 1. Launch the Internet Explorer and enter FTP://192.168.1.1. 2. In the Login dialog box, enter the user name and the password for logging in to the FTP server (the default user name and password are ftp) and then click Login. 3. After the password is verified, you can read and write the contents on the portable storage device connected to the terminal. ----End 6-8 Huawei Proprietary and Confidential Copyright ©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d
